The editor decodes your encrypted save string into readable text. Once you make your desired changes, the tool re-encodes the data into a fresh string that you can paste back into your game. Key Features of the V2.022 Editor
Editing your save allows you to manipulate sugar lumps, which directly impact the mini-games added in later versions like v2.022. You can give yourself infinite Sugar Lumps to level up your Wizard Towers (unlocking the Grimoire) and Temples (unlocking the Pantheon) to maximum levels instantly. Modifying your save file is a straightforward process, but it requires precision so you do not accidentally corrupt your data. Step 1: Back Up Your Original Save Before touching any editor, protect your hard work. Open your active game. Click on Options at the top of the screen. Click Export Save .
